Abstract
												Multi-wall carbon nanotube (MWCNT) with large aspect ratio was prepared on a large scale via Co-catalyzed pyrolysis of cheap pitch at 973-1273â¯K in Ar atmosphere. The optimal catalyst-content and temperature for growing CNT was 1173â¯K and 0.75â¯wt% Co, respectively. The schematic of the formation of MWCNTs can be shown as follows:(a) Co(NO3)2 gradually decomposed to cobalt (â
¡) starting at about 473â¯K;(b) pitch decomposed and released considerable amounts of C2H4 gas;(c) the subsequent separations of C-H and C=C bonds in C2H4;(d) MWCNTs grew from/on the Co cluster via diffusion-penetration.Density functional theory (DFT) calculations suggest that Co catalysts facilitate the CNTs growth by donating electrons from Co atoms to C2H4 molecules, which facilitated the dissociation of the C=C and the C-H bonds.192
